They defeated Heritage Christian on October 27th in a WIAA Division 4 Sectional Semi-Final match at home, 25-18, 25-5, 25-19. On October 29th, they won over the Green Bay N.E.W. Lutheran team at Oshkosh, 23-25, 25-12, 27-25, 25-12, to win the Sectional Championship.
The Ponies have been seeded #3 for the WIAA Division 4 State Tournament. They play #2 seeded Athens at 9:00 a.m., on Friday, November 4th, at the Resch Center in Green Bay. The winner goes on to play for the state championship against the winner of the #1 McDonell Central Catholic vs #4 Wonewoc-Center match on Saturday, November 5th, at 9:00 a.m.
